Stay connected with the journey of Chris Spicer as he spends 6 months in jail as a prisoner of conscience in protest of the School of Americas. Sunday, March 27, 2011. Questioning our direction of this blog. Visiting Chris in Seattle. You have to fill out a form and provide 2 or 3 forms of ID. It takes maybe 7 - 10 days to process. Once you submit the form and it is processed, you receive an approval letter from the prison. You must MUST be on time to a visit.not even one minute late. One of Chris' frien...
